What: Baltimore dream-rock outfit Lower Dens attend a slightly wacky corporate team-building camp, compelte with ropes course and trust falls, in the music video for "Candy". The band's latest album, Nootropics , is out now via Ribbon Music. Directed by: Alan Resnick and Noah Collier

Lower Dens opened the fourth show of the 2012 Twilight Concert Series promoting their sophomore album Nootropics . For a front woman, Hunter sure did like to hide behind her instruments on the outskirts of the stage, and opted for the other three members to share the spotlight. New songs like "Candy" and "Brains" drew those who arrived early in closer to the stage. It was "In the End is the Beginning" that really showcased band's talented individuals. Band of Horses has steadily gained recognition locally since their first show in SLC in the spring of 2006. The brought down the house at Kilby Court playing "The Great Salt Lake", and with their next visit four years later, they opened with the song named after the same lake as our city for a sold out crowd. Last week's TCS brought in over 20k people, and in anticipation of the band's third show here, we've already seen Band of Horses tickets at the top of the chart for online presale tickets for over a month.
